Conclusion Meanings:
'SRAD Closure': Strategic Resource Allocation Determination - due to citywide budget cuts, CCRB is no longer able to fully investigate certain cases within its jurisdiction and suspended investigating some types of complaints.
'Substantiated': The misconduct occurred and it violated the rules. The NYPD has discretion over what, if any, discipline is imposed.
'Unable to Determine': The alleged conduct was investigated but could not determine both that the conduct occurred and that it broke the rules.

Fadeyibi, Adeola, et al. vs City of Ny, et al.
Case # 521322/2022,
Supreme Court - Kings, July 28, 2022
Complaint
Description: On June 19, 2021, at or around 1890 Eastern Parkway in Kings County, Plaintiffs Adeola Dadeyibi and Shawn Ealey were forcibly seized without warrant or probable cause by Defendant NYPD Police Officers. Plaintiffs were handcuffed, arrested, detained, and imprisoned against their will, then prosecuted for crimes of which they were innocent. Defendants Sgt. Frantz Chauvet and Police Officer John Freund falsely accused plaintiffs of various criminal acts.
Plaintiffs bring claims of: assault and battery, false arrest and false imprisonment, malicious prosecution, fourth and fourteenth amendment violations, denial of right to a fair trial, and failure to intervene.
Destefano, Seth P. vs City of New York, et al.
Case # 500840/2017,
Supreme Court - Kings, January 20, 2017, ended March 10, 2020
$37,500 Settlement
Complaint
Description: On February 7, 2016, Plaintiff was lawfully present at or about the L train of the NY Transit authority while at the Jefferson Street subway stop in Kings county on the way to manhattan. Plaintiff was assaulted and battered by Defendants, NYPD Officer Frantz Chauvet and Officers John Does. Plaintiff was also falsely arrested and confined by Defendants without probable cause. Defendants took out action that exceeded the bounds of decency, were outrageous and shocking and caused Plaintiff severe emotional distress. Plaintiff suffered pain, distress, mental shock, physical pain and psychological trauma as a result of Defendants actions.
